mysql初始化不了的原因有哪些

2024-04-18

  1. 数据库服务未启动:如果MySQL数据库服务未启动,那么无法进行初始化操作。请检查数据库服务是否已经启动。

  2. 数据库配置文件错误:数据库配置文件中的参数设置错误可能导致数据库无法启动。请检查配置文件中的参数设置是否正确。

  3. 数据库版本不兼容:如果使用的MySQL版本与初始化脚本不兼容,可能导致初始化失败。请确保使用的MySQL版本符合初始化脚本的要求。

  4. 数据库表结构错误:如果数据库表结构设置错误或缺少必要的表结构,可能导致初始化失败。请检查数据库表结构是否正确。

  5. 数据库权限不足:如果执行初始化操作的用户没有足够的权限进行操作,可能导致初始化失败。请确保使用有足够权限的用户进行初始化操作。

  6. 数据库磁盘空间不足:如果数据库磁盘空间不足,可能导致初始化失败。请检查数据库磁盘空间是否足够。

  7. 数据库数据文件损坏:数据库数据文件损坏可能导致数据库无法启动。请尝试修复损坏的数据文件或恢复备份数据。

  8. 其他未知原因:还有可能存在其他未知的原因导致数据库初始化失败,需要进一步排查。